Establishing Data Excellence as Foundation
Quality data serves as the foundation for any successful AI initiative. Retailers must audit existing data sources, identifying gaps in coverage, consistency issues, and integration challenges across systems. Customer data platforms that unify information from point-of-sale systems, e-commerce platforms, loyalty programs, and customer service interactions enable comprehensive analysis while maintaining data governance standards.
Data labeling and preparation typically consume the majority of AI project timelines. Organizations should invest in tools and processes that streamline these activities, whether through automated annotation systems, third-party labeling services, or synthetic data generation techniques. Establishing data quality metrics and implementing continuous monitoring ensures that model performance remains reliable as business conditions evolve.
Privacy-preserving techniques like differential privacy and federated learning allow retailers to extract insights from customer data while maintaining compliance with regulatory requirements and ethical standards. These approaches prove particularly valuable when working with sensitive information or operating across jurisdictions with varying privacy regulations.
Adopting Incremental Deployment Strategies
Phased rollouts minimize risk while accelerating learning cycles. Start with limited deployments in controlled environments—perhaps a single store location or product category—where teams can validate assumptions, gather performance data, and refine approaches before broader implementation. This measured approach builds organizational confidence and generates proof points that facilitate executive support for scaling initiatives. A/B testing frameworks enable rigorous evaluation of AI interventions against baseline performance. By randomly assigning customers or stores to treatment and control groups, retailers can isolate the impact of AI systems from other variables and quantify return on investment with statistical confidence. These experimental designs also reveal unintended consequences or edge cases that require attention.
Change management processes ensure that frontline employees understand new systems and embrace technology-enabled workflows. Training programs, clear communication about how AI augments rather than replaces human judgment, and feedback mechanisms that capture employee insights all contribute to successful adoption. Resistance to AI initiatives often stems from inadequate preparation rather than inherent opposition to technology.
